ASI and ASISSE — Which One Applies to You?

ASI (Annual Survey of Industries): Manufacturing survey — factories, electricity undertakings, industrial units under the Factories Act, 1948. Gurgaon's IMT Manesar, Udyog Vihar, and Sector 37 industrial areas house manufacturing units in auto components, electronics, and engineering goods that can appear in ASI samples.

ASISSE (Annual Survey of Incorporated Services Sector Enterprises): Launched April 2026. Covers IT, ITES, financial services, trade, transport, hospitality, real estate, healthcare, professional services — incorporated entities only. The majority of Gurgaon's ASISSE notices will fall here.

Both surveys run under the Collection of Statistics Act, 2008 (amended 2017) and the Jan Vishwas Act, 2023.

Important: These surveys are legally and operationally separate from GST or Income Tax. The Act prohibits NSO from sharing submitted data with the IT Department, GST authorities, SEBI, or RBI for enforcement. What you submit stays within the statistical system.

Penalty Structure

Default Stage Penalty
Failure or refusal to furnish information Up to Rupees 5,000 (companies) / Rupees 1,000 (individuals)
Non-compliance continuing beyond 14 days Up to Rupees 5,000 per day (companies) / Rupees 1,000 per day (individuals)
Wilful submission of false information Imprisonment up to 6 months and/or fine
Recovery mechanism As arrears of land revenue under Section 15C

Penalty payment doesn't close the filing obligation.

Notice Verification and GSTIN Scoping We authenticate the notice, identify the selected Haryana GSTIN(s), check the reference period, and map your exact obligation. Many Gurgaon companies — particularly IT and fintech firms — have GSTINs across 20+ states. Each selected GSTIN files independently.

Block-by-Block Data Preparation The questionnaire covers specific data blocks — enterprise identity and NIC classification (Block 1), fixed assets (Block 3), working capital and borrowings (Block 4), employment headcount by gender (Block 5), intermediate consumption under CPC 3.0 (Blocks 6A & 6B), revenue and output (Block 7A), digital technology infrastructure (Blocks 11 & 12). For IT and fintech companies, Block 12's digital infrastructure questions are particularly detailed.

Financial Reconciliation GST returns, P&L, balance sheet, payroll register, and fixed asset schedule — all reconciled before portal submission. For Gurgaon-based MNC Indian subsidiaries and holding company structures, this requires tracing what's captured in the Indian entity versus what flows to the parent.

Documents Required

  • Audited Balance Sheet and P&L for FY 2024–25
  • Trial balance
  • GST returns and Haryana GSTIN-wise turnover breakdowns
  • Payroll register with gender-wise headcount split
  • Fixed asset schedule with depreciation
  • Working capital and loan statements
  • Production records and raw material data (ASI filers in Manesar/Udyog Vihar)
  • Electricity and fuel cost data
  • Factory licence (ASI filers)
  • NIC 2025 primary activity classification

Frequently Asked Questions

We're an MNC subsidiary in Gurgaon. Our India entity received an ASISSE notice. Does this affect our parent company? No. ASISSE only applies to your Indian incorporated entity. The data submitted covers your Indian operations under the Haryana GSTIN. Your parent company's data is not in scope.

Our Gurgaon office is just a registered office — actual operations run from multiple states. What data do we submit? You submit data specific to the Haryana GSTIN that received the notice. If your Haryana GSTIN captures certain revenue and employees, that's what goes into the return — not your consolidated pan-India data.

We have a fintech company in Gurgaon with a PAN-India customer base. How does revenue get reported? Revenue gets reported as captured under the Haryana GSTIN for the financial year — as per GST returns and audited financials for that registration.
